Thank you for expressing an interest in applying for a post at Oldham Sixth Form College. Working here can be both demanding and challenging, but we hope that all our staff also find it a rewarding and fulfilling experience.
We currently employ approximately 200 members of staff, representing both teaching and support roles, and operate a policy based on treating the whole staff as one. The Senior Management Team currently comprises the Principal, one Deputy Principal, two Vice Principals and seven Assistant Principals. Academic Departments, Student Services and all support staff report, through administrative and technical teams, to a member of the Senior Management Team.
For teaching staff, the excellent New Staff Support Programme provides structured input on College systems and policies. For more information please see the section on the New Staff Programme.
There is an annual review programme for all staff which considers performance and identifies development and training needs at both personal level and in line with the College’s priorities. This programme is well established and has helped many staff gain promotion both within the College and externally. There is a strong tradition of the College “growing its own” in terms of staff promotions and increasingly through ex-students returning as staff.
We offer an excellent working environment and have invested heavily in resources to support teaching and
learning. There is a comfortable staff room and well-equipped staff workrooms and offices. The maintenance of the College Buildings is always a high priority and all staff and students value the high quality of the surroundings in which they work.
